Nurse Practitioner/Physician Assistant
This provider is responsible for high quality medical care in a primary care setting for students at Plymouth State University working both independently as well as working collaboratively to coordinate care with the other providers and staff to provide patient and family-centered service.
Essential Job Functions:
- Analyze patient's medical history and health status, examine and evaluate physical condition, order and evaluate results from imaging and testing to verify appropriate treatment
- Diagnose bodily disorders and medical conditions, develop treatment plans and provide treatments in office and hospital settings
- Perform minor procedures to repair injuries, prevent and treat disease, and improve or restore patient's function as granted in clinical privileges by the Board of Directors.
- Provide consultation to other physicians and surgeons
- Orders and interprets laboratory tests and radiological examinations.
- Recognizes and evaluates patients who require the immediate attention of a provider and when necessary, initiates, without supervision, emergency medical treatments.
- Instructs and counsels patients in matters pertaining to their physical and mental health.
- Maintains and signs medical records pertaining to treatments and examinations administered. Completes documentation in University's medical record daily.
- Ensures confidentiality of patient information.
- Participates in continuing medical education.
- Actively participate in the hospital's quality and patient experience program; working with the team in the practice to continually improve the patient experience. Supports quality improvement activities in the clinic.
- Complies with hospital and departmental policies, procedures, regulations and standards as related to job.
- Demonstrates hospital's stated mission and values of kindness, collaboration, patient and family-centered, safety, excellence, efficiency and professionalism with co-workers, patients, families and visitors.
- Actively and appropriately participates in problem-solving identification and resolution, both intra- and inter-departmentally.
- Meets department customer service standards and strives to enhance the level of customer service provided.
